Description

Usage

Teokap SR is a bronchodilator medication that helps to treat and prevent respiratory distress caused by the obstruction of the airways in patients with persistent bronchial asthma or moderate to severe obstructive respiratory tract disease such as chronic bronchitis and pulmonary emphysema. The active substance in Teokap SR is theophylline, which is released gradually over time, providing long-lasting relief to patients.

Precautions

Before taking Teokap SR, it’s important to let your doctor know if you have any pre-existing medical conditions, such as heart disease, hypertension, hyperthyroidism, epilepsy, gastric ulcers, liver or kidney dysfunction, or porphyria. It’s also essential to avoid Teokap SR if you have recently suffered a heart attack or have an acute heart rhythm disorder with a rapid heartbeat.

While taking Teokap SR, it’s crucial to monitor your symptoms carefully and report any unusual side effects to your doctor immediately. Additionally, if you are undergoing electroconvulsive therapy, be aware that theophylline may prolong the duration of spasm.

Possible Side Effects

Like all medications, Teokap SR can cause side effects, although not everyone experiences them. The most common side effects of Teokap SR include irritability, mild temporary caffeine-like effects such as headache, nausea, diarrhea, trouble sleeping, mild temporary changes in behavior, restlessness, and temporary increased urination.

It’s important to note that these side effects are generally mild and temporary, and they usually subside over time. However, if you experience any unusual or severe side effects while taking Teokap SR, it’s essential to speak with your doctor immediately.
